summaryrefslogtreecommitdiffstats
path: root/include
diff options
context:
space:
mode:
authorYork Sun <york.sun@nxp.com>2018-11-05 18:02:09 +0000
committerYork Sun <york.sun@nxp.com>2018-12-06 14:37:19 -0800
commit56db948b85aa7c03c79b2c796500de4523924a9d (patch)
tree66a4244e1f6382be7584687574284be3b92cb71b /include
parent5a73ec6169d1db85eacc4ad2fc74dad92a846c9e (diff)
downloadu-boot-56db948b85aa7c03c79b2c796500de4523924a9d.tar.gz
u-boot-56db948b85aa7c03c79b2c796500de4523924a9d.tar.xz
u-boot-56db948b85aa7c03c79b2c796500de4523924a9d.zip
armv8: fsl-layerscape: Update parsing boot source
Workaround of erratum A010539 clears the RCW source field in PORSR1 register, causing failure of detecting boot source using this method. Use SMC call if U-Boot runs at EL2. If SMC is not implemented or running at EL3, continue to read PORSR1 and presume QSPI as boot source if erratum workaround A010539 is enabled and RCW source is cleared. Signed-off-by: York Sun <york.sun@nxp.com>
Diffstat (limited to 'include')
0 files changed, 0 insertions, 0 deletions